Effect of Sleep on Metabolic rate



Absence of sleep can dramatically decrease your metabolic rate and prevent your weight reduction development. When you don't get adequate sleep, your body's capacity to regulate hormones like insulin, cortisol, and ghrelin is interfered with. This discrepancy can bring about boosted cravings, food cravings for junk foods, and a decline in the variety of calories your body burns at rest.

Research has revealed that rest starvation can alter your metabolism in a manner that makes it more challenging to reduce weight. When you're sleep-deprived, your body tends to hold onto fat shops and shed less calories, making it a lot more tough to develop the calorie shortage required for fat burning. Additionally, insufficient sleep can affect your power degrees and motivation to workout, additional hindering your progress in the direction of your weight reduction objectives.



To sustain your metabolism and weight reduction efforts, focus on getting 7-9 hours of top quality rest each evening. By boosting your sleep routines, you can boost your body's ability to regulate hormonal agents, increase metabolic rate, and sustain your weight reduction journey.

Influence of Sleep on Hunger Hormonal Agents



Obtaining enough rest plays a critical duty in managing appetite hormonal agents, influencing your hunger and food choices. When obesity balloon treatment do not get adequate sleep, it can disrupt the equilibrium of crucial hormones that control appetite and satiety, resulting in boosted cravings and overindulging.

Here's exactly how rest affects your hunger hormonal agents:

- ** Leptin Levels **: Rest deprival can lower leptin degrees, the hormonal agent responsible for indicating volume to your brain. When leptin levels are reduced, you may really feel hungrier and much less pleased after eating.

- ** Ghrelin Levels **: Lack of sleep has a tendency to raise ghrelin levels, the hormonal agent that stimulates appetite. Raised ghrelin levels can make you long for extra high-calorie foods, bring about potential weight gain.

- ** Insulin Sensitivity **: Poor rest can decrease insulin sensitivity, making it harder for your body to manage blood sugar degrees. This can result in boosted hunger and a higher risk of establishing insulin resistance.

Prioritizing top quality rest can aid preserve a healthy equilibrium of these hunger hormones, sustaining your weight management initiatives.

Importance of Sleep in Weight Administration



To efficiently handle your weight, making sure sufficient rest is crucial as it directly affects key hormonal agents associated with hunger guideline and weight loss success. When you do not get enough rest, the hormonal agent ghrelin boosts, boosting your appetite and possibly resulting in overeating. Alternatively, not enough sleep decreases leptin degrees, the hormonal agent in charge of signifying volume, making it simpler to eat even more calories than your body demands. Furthermore, inadequate sleep can interfere with insulin level of sensitivity, placing you in jeopardy for weight gain and metabolic issues.

Furthermore, poor rest can influence your food options, making you most likely to hunger for high-calorie and sweet foods for quick power increases. Being sleep-deprived can additionally impede your motivation to work out, even more complicating weight administration efforts. By prioritizing high quality sleep, you support your body's ability to regulate cravings hormonal agents, make much healthier food options, and stay energetic, all of which are necessary elements of effective weight management. So, aim for 7 to 9 hours of peaceful rest each night to maximize your weight management trip.
